Advances in Gene Editing Technologies can Propel Market Diversification in Upcoming Years

Advances in gene editing technologies, particularly CRISPR, which enable more precise and efficient cell modification for therapeutic purposes, will continue to have a major impact on the market for cell therapy biomanufacturing. These advancements make it possible to create specifically designed therapies, such gene-corrected stem cells that address the root causes of inherited diseases with increased precision and fewer side effects. As gene editing becomes more advanced, scalable, and cost-effective, it will improve patient outcomes, expand the range of illnesses that may be treated, and raise the demand for biomanufacturing expertise. This will further drive the market expansion for cell therapy biomanufacturing.
